OverviewJake and Emily are fourth graders at Lincoln Elementary. On a visit to the city library, they discovered a time machine in a hidden closet. This is their fifth adventure, traveling to the late 1800s to visit Alexander Graham Bell. The kids meet him and find that he is very discouraged and thinking of giving up trying to invent the telephone. He has had repeated failures and the townspeople were making fun of him. The kids convince him that the telephone is vital for the future and get him to promise to continue. Upon getting home, the kids discover and unpleasant surprise, prompting a return to Mr. Bell.
